2nd Test: Rain delays India’s impending series victory over Sri Lanka on Day 4

Sri Lanka ended day four of the second Test at 229 for six after India’s bowlers struck late. Pasindu Sooriyabandara and Kamindu Mendis led the fightback with a 115-run stand, while Sonal Dinusha scored 103 earlier. India’s late wickets put them in control, but rain and bad light halted play, leaving Sri Lanka fighting to avoid defeat on day five.
